The Pathogens Management Train (PMT) is a comprehensive framework designed to identify and mitigate the transmission of pathogens across all stages of the public health engineering cycle. It addresses vulnerabilities not only in water supply but also in drainage systems—often overlooked in conventional design. The PMT consists of seven critical stages where pathogen exposure can occur: (Stage 1) Source, (Stage 2) Storage, (Stage 3) Distribution, (Stage 4) Use, (Stage 5) Traps, (Stage 6) Drainage, and (Stage 7) Recycling or Outfall. By applying targeted interventions at each of these stages, the PMT helps create safer, healthier building environments and supports infection control strategies across various sectors. PMT Stage 6 addresses contamination risks throughout the drainage and vent stack system, with a special focus on inter-floor cross-contamination, dry traps, and pressure fluctuations. Understanding the Risk: Contaminants from Plumbing Vents
Ventilation pipes in drainage systems play a vital role in balancing pressure and expelling sewer gases. However, they can also act as unintentional exhaust points for harmful pollutants, such as:
- Sewer gases (hydrogen sulphide, methane, ammonia)
- Aerosolized bacteria and viruses
- Foul odours and volatile organic compounds (VOCs)
These emissions can spread into the building or surrounding air, compromising air quality and posing health risks, especially when vent stacks are near air intakes, windows, or shared HVAC systems.

What is NCCO?
Nano Confined Catalytic Oxidation (NCCO) is an advanced air purification technology that eliminates pathogens in drainage vent systems through a continuous catalytic oxidation process. As contaminated air passes through the NCCO core, a specialized catalyst within nano-scale porous structures generates reactive oxygen species (ROS) that break down the cell walls, proteins, and genetic material of bacteria, viruses, and other bioaerosols. This effectively destroys the pathogens and converts them into harmless byproducts such as carbon dioxide and water vapor. Unlike traditional filters that merely trap contaminants, NCCO neutralizes them at the molecular level, providing a passive, maintenance-friendly, and long-lasting solution for improving hygiene and preventing airborne disease transmission in building drainage systems.
